Review of Viscosity Modifier Lubricant Additives

Thickening efficiency describes the amount of polymer that has to be used in a given lubricant formulation and is quantified as the polymer treat rate required to reach a desired viscosity. Here we use the definition of thickening efficiency as the polymer treat rate to achieve a given kinematic viscosity at 100 C [3].

New lubricant additives save fuel

These specialty polymers exhibit outstanding properties as temperature-sensitive thickening agents in lubricants. By forming coil like structures in the lubricant, comb polymers are able to influence lubricant viscosity: the polymeric coils expand considerably at elevated temperatures, thus thickening the lubricant more than traditional ...

Core-Crosslinked Star Copolymers as Viscosity Index …

As polymer additives are one of the most expensive components of a lubricant formulation, it is highly desirable to develop additives with high thickening efficiency. Moreover, polymeric additives undergo mechanical shear-induced chain breaking reactions, which determine a decrease of the lubricant viscosity.
